2 Pakistanis selected for Facebook’s artificial intelligence promotion project

Facebook, the world’s largest social networking site, has also selected two Pakistani experts for its announced funding project for a project to promote artificial intelligence in the Asian region.

Facebook has teamed up with the Center for Civil Society and Governance at the University of Hong Kong and the Privacy Commissioner for Personal Data (PCPD) at the University of Hong Kong to support the ethics of artificial intelligence (AI) in the Asian region. Will work

Facebook launched the project in December last year, with support from active and registered educational institutions, think tanks and research institutes in several Asian countries.

To pursue the same project and promote the artificial intelligence of artificial intelligence in the Asian region, Facebook has selected technologists from 9 countries in the region, including Pakistan, as Principal Investigators (PIs) and selected individuals. Will provide funds.

Two Pakistani experts are also among the principal investigators from nine countries in the Asian region selected by Facebook.

According to a statement issued by Facebook, Professor Junaid Qadir of Punjab University of Information Technology (ITU) and Amana Raqib of Sindh Institute of Business Administration (IBA) Karachi are also from Pakistan.

Both Pakistani experts will assist Facebook’s Asian team in the ethical promotion and research of artificial intelligence in the region.

Junaid Qadir has been active in the University of Information Technology, Lahore since April 2020 as a Professor and has been serving as the Chairman of the Department of Electrical Engineering since January 2019.

He completed his PhD from the University of New South Wales, Australia in 2008 and a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ering from the University of Engineering and Technology, Lahore in 2000.

Amana Raqib completed her PhD in Religious Philosophy and Ethics with distinction from the University of Queensland, Australia. She previously graduated in Philosophy from Karachi University with a book, Islamic Ethics of Technology, In Objectives Approach. Is the author.
